Common Causes of Rust Staining Near Access Panels
Identifying the source of the moisture is the first step in resolving rust staining. There are several common causes that handymen and maintenance professionals look for during an inspection:
Condensation Buildup: In bathrooms and laundry rooms, high humidity can condense on cold metal surfaces, such as access panel frames or plumbing pipes. Over time, this constant moisture leads to surface rust, which then stains the surrounding drywall or paint. This is particularly common in homes with inadequate ventilation.
Slow Plumbing Leaks: Access panels often cover main plumbing stacks or shut-off valves. A slow drip from a joint, a corroded pipe, or a failing washer can wet the back of the drywall and the metal panel. The water travels along the panel edges, causing rust to form on the screws and frame, which then bleeds through the surface.
Improper Sealing: If the access panel was not properly caulked or sealed during installation, moisture from the room can get behind the panel. Conversely, moisture from the wall cavity can escape through gaps, causing rust on the exterior of the panel. In Winnetka’s older homes, original caulk may have dried out and cracked, allowing water intrusion.
Exterior Water Intrusion: For access panels located in basements or exterior walls, water can seep in from the outside due to poor grading, clogged gutters, or cracks in the foundation. This water can travel along the wall cavity and emerge near the access panel, causing rust and staining.
Diagnostic Steps: What to Look For
Before scheduling a repair, it is helpful to perform a few basic checks to gather information for the service provider. These steps can help determine the severity of the issue and guide the repair process.
Visual Inspection: Look closely at the rust staining. Is it concentrated around the screws and hinges, or does it spread outward from the center of the panel? Concentrated rust around hardware suggests surface moisture or condensation. Spreading stains may indicate a leak behind the wall. Check for paint bubbling, peeling, or discoloration, which are signs of prolonged moisture exposure.
Touch Test: Gently press on the drywall around the access panel. If it feels soft, spongy, or crumbles slightly, there is likely water damage behind the surface. This requires immediate attention to prevent further deterioration. Also, check if the panel itself feels loose or if the screws are stripped, which can happen when rust weakens the metal.
Smell Check: Sniff around the access panel. A musty, earthy, or mildew-like odor suggests mold growth, which thrives in damp environments. If you detect this smell, it is important to address the moisture source and clean the area thoroughly to prevent health issues.
Moisture Meter: If you have access to a moisture meter, use it to check the drywall around the panel. High readings indicate significant moisture content, confirming the need for professional repair. This tool can help distinguish between surface dampness and deep-seated water damage.
Moisture Control and Ventilation Solutions
Effective access panel repair involves more than just fixing the rust; it requires addressing the environmental conditions that caused it. Moisture control is critical in preventing future staining and corrosion.
Improving Ventilation: In bathrooms and laundry rooms, ensure that exhaust fans are functioning correctly and venting to the outside, not just into the attic or wall cavity. Run the fan during and for at least 20 minutes after showers or laundry cycles to reduce humidity. Consider installing a timer or humidity-sensing fan for automatic operation. In Winnetka homes with older ventilation systems, upgrading to a more efficient fan can make a significant difference.
Dehumidification: In basements or utility rooms with high humidity, a dehumidifier can help maintain optimal moisture levels. Aim for a relative humidity between 30% and 50% to prevent condensation on metal surfaces. This is especially important during the humid summer months in the Chicago area.
Sealing Gaps: Apply a high-quality, mold-resistant caulk around the edges of the access panel to create a watertight seal. This prevents moisture from entering the wall cavity and protects the panel frame from direct exposure to humid air. Ensure the caulk is compatible with the materials of the panel and the surrounding wall.
Repairing Rust Stains and Restoring the Finish
Once the moisture source is addressed, the rust staining and damaged materials need to be repaired. This process involves cleaning, treating, and refinishing the area to restore a clean, professional look.
Removing Rust: Use a wire brush or sandpaper to remove loose rust from the access panel frame, screws, and hinges. For stubborn rust, a rust converter or remover can be applied to neutralize the corrosion and prevent it from spreading. Wear protective gloves and a mask during this process to avoid inhaling rust particles.
Replacing Hardware: If the screws or hinges are severely corroded, replace them with stainless steel or coated alternatives that are resistant to rust. This ensures long-term durability and prevents future staining. Stainless steel hardware is particularly recommended for high-moisture areas like bathrooms.
Repairing Drywall: If the drywall is stained or damaged, it may need to be patched or replaced. Cut out the affected area, apply a stain-blocking primer, and then patch with joint compound. Sand smooth and repaint to match the surrounding wall. For extensive damage, a larger section of drywall may need to be replaced.

Painting and Finishing: Use a rust-inhibitive primer on the metal panel before painting. This creates a barrier that prevents moisture from reaching the metal and causing new rust. Choose a high-quality, moisture-resistant paint for the surrounding wall to ensure a durable finish. In bathrooms, consider using a semi-gloss or satin finish, which is easier to clean and more resistant to humidity.

FAQ: Access Panel Rust Staining Repair
Q: How do I know if the rust staining is from a leak or just condensation?
A: If the stain is concentrated around the panel edges and hardware, it is likely condensation. If the stain spreads outward from the center or is accompanied by soft drywall, it may be a leak. A professional inspection can confirm the source.
Q: Can I paint over rust staining without treating the rust first?
A: No, painting over rust without treatment will not stop the corrosion. The rust will continue to spread and bleed through the paint. You must remove the rust and apply a rust-inhibitive primer before painting.
Q: Is it safe to leave a rust-stained access panel unrepaired?
A: It is not recommended. Rust staining indicates moisture, which can lead to drywall rot, mold growth, and structural damage. Addressing the issue early prevents more extensive and costly repairs.
Q: How often should I inspect access panels for rust?
A: Inspect access panels at least twice a year, especially in high-moisture areas like bathrooms and basements. Regular inspections help catch issues early before they become major problems.
Q: What type of caulk should I use around an access panel?
A: Use a high-quality, mold-resistant silicone or acrylic latex caulk. These types of caulk are flexible, durable, and resistant to moisture, making them ideal for sealing access panels.
Q: Can I replace the access panel screws myself?
A: Yes, if the screws are accessible and not stripped. Use stainless steel or coated screws to prevent future rust. If the screws are stuck or the panel is difficult to remove, consider calling a professional.
